New Guidelines Available Online
As part of the ongoing inaugural rulemaking required by the 2024 Climate Act, DOER's Division of Clean Energy Siting & Permitting has released four sets of guidelines to assist in the local permitting of small clean energy infrastructure projects.
These guidelines support 225 CMR 29.00, the new regulation being finalized by the Department that outlines the new consolidated permitting process certain applicants may take advantage of starting later this year.
The Executive Office of Energy & Environmental Affairs released its 2025 Massachusetts Climate Report Card, which informs Massachusetts residents of progress being made toward achieving climate goals and mandates.
The report, which can be found here, features both high-level goals as well as specific targets and initiatives.
The Siting & Permitting Team
The Clean Energy Siting & Permitting Division features four Regional Coordinators charged with assisting municipalities, applicants, and other stakeholders.
